Skip to Content

120 Amazing Nicknames For John For Your Favorite Guy

120 Amazing Nicknames For John For Your Favorite Guy

If you’ve been trying to come up with the best nickname for a John in your life, you’ll find plenty of help in this article. I’ve done some research and collected 120 fantastic pet names for a guy named John.

Top 20 Nicknames For John

smiling man talking on cellphone

First, let’s look at some of the most popular nicknames for John. These pet name ideas are perfect if you want something simple and easy to remember.

1. Jim

2. Jan

3. Jon

4. Johnny

5. Jack

6. Jonny

7. Jackin

8. John-John

9. Jock

10. Jackie

11. Joe

12. Johnnie

13. Jax

14. Jocko

15. James

16. Jay

17. Jankin

18. Jim

19. Johannes

20. Jacky

Cute Nicknames For John

smiling man looking at distance outdoor

If you’re looking for an adorable baby name or moniker for your special person, check out these ideas!

1. Joy – he brings you nothing but joy and happiness.

2. Lil John – he lies about his height in his Tinder bio.

3. Jono – cute nickname for a special cutie.

4. Jackfruit – sweet as a banana.

5. Mini-John – a baby that is the spitting image of his dad, who is also named John.

6. Baby John – he’s just a baby. Even though he’s 26, he’s your baby.

7. Jo Jo – one of the cutest baby names. It can’t get cuter than this!

8. Jam – he can eat strawberry jam all day, every day.

9. Little John – a lovely nickname for a kid that is very dear to you.

10. Baby Jay – if I had a boyfriend named John, I would call him Baby Jay. Not in front of his friends, of course.

See also: Nicknames For Charlie: 120 Ideas You Simply Can’t Miss

Funny Nicknames For John

If you want a nickname that is funny and a little teasing, these are perfect for you.

1. Johnnie Walker – a guy with refined taste and a tremendous thirst.

2. Jonny Casino – he leads an exciting life.

3. Cousin John – a simple nickname for a cousin.

4. Junk – if he overeats junk food, call him Junk (hopefully, it makes him think about his food choices).

5. Jon Bon Jovi – it’s easy to tell who his favorite musician is.

6. Red John – he’s really shy.

7. Papa John – his kid is three and loves listening to ‘Johny Johny Yes Papa’.

8. Johny Bean – a small guy who can fit into your pocket.

9. Jonas Brother – he has a crush on Priyanka Chopra.

10. Joker – he laughs too much it scares you.

11. Jiggle Wiggle – he likes to wiggle wiggle.

12. Jay Z – he’s in love with Beyonce and hopes to become the next Jay Z someday.

13. Johnica – perfect nickname for a guy who acts like a drama queen all the time.

14. Jigglypuff – this guy appears cute and harmless but is actually very dangerous.

15. Jumbo – a guy who can eat a jumbo-sized pizza alone.

16. Jelly Bean – he’s sweet, irresistible, and bad for your health.

17. Yawn – is this guy ever not tired?

18. Die Hard – inspired by one of Bruce Willis’ most famous movies.

19. Jon Snow – he knows nothing.

20. JFK – a guy who aspires to become as great as President Kennedy.

Unique Nicknames For John

smiling young man looking at distance

There are loads of great nicknames for John besides the common and cute ones!

If you’re searching for something unique and original that only a few people have, check out these pet name ideas.

1. Jock – a simple guy who loves beer and soccer.

2. Giovanni – he was born in Rome.

3. Jack Sparrow – he’s weird yet charming. You don’t know what to think about him.

4. J Star – everybody wants to be like him.

5. Legend – a perfect nickname for a romantic guy whose favorite song is ‘All of me’.

6. Janneke – for a touch of dutch, choose this one.

7. Juan – he’s from Madrid.

8. Jackpot – having him as a boyfriend is better than winning a jackpot.

9. Jiffy – Jiffy is always there even when no one invites him (but it’s ok, he’s not annoying).

10. John Boy – looks average on the outside, yet inside lies a beast.

11. Jack Daniels – whiskey lover. You’re never in a dilemma about what to get him for his birthday.

12. John Carter – another movie-inspired nickname.

13. Rambo – do I need to explain this?

14. J Smith – kinda looks like Brad Pitt.

15. Jolie – a guy in love with Angelina Jolie.

See also: Top 80 Nicknames For Theodore: The Ultimate Collection

Interesting Variants Of The Name John

handsome man with curly hair smiling outdoor

The name John is used across the globe. Different languages gave birth to various other forms of the name. Here are some interesting variants of the name, such as Italian, Spanish, Lithuanian, etc.

1. Janis

2. Hanne

3. Joao

4. Hans

5. Ioannes

6. Gianni

7. Chuan

8. Ivan

9. Gino

10. Jovan

11. Yohanan

12. Hannes

13. Yann

14. Xhoni

15. Johan

16. Evan

17. Jonas

18. Johann

19. Ian

20. Jaan

Female Versions Of The Name John

smiling woman with curly hair texting outdoor

These beautiful girl names are female variants of the name John.

If you have a boy named John and are now expecting a baby girl, you can give her one of these cute names. They would make a perfect combination!

1. Gianna

2. Janis

3. Joanna

4. Janice

5. Ivanka

6. Jolene

7. Jovana

8. Johanna

9. Janet

10. Janelle

11. Jana

12. Nina

13. Jane

14. Jean

15. Hannah

16. Iva

17. Janina

18. Janneke

19. Janke

20. Janine

Famous People Named John

Some of the most remarkable people in modern history have had the name John. Here are some of them.

1. John Cena – he is one of the most famous sportsmen of all time.

2. John Lennon – one of the greatest musicians, who was brutally murdered.

3. John F. Kenndey – another horrible assassination that shook the world.

4. J.R.R Tolkien – full name John Ronald Reuel Tolkien. A man thanks to whom we enjoy some of the world’s greatest fantasy novels.

5. John Travolta – he’s not a dancer, but he can dance!

Middle Names For John

smiling man posing at camera

Here are some lovely boy names perfect to be used as a middle name for the first name John.

1. Adam

2. James

3. Caleb

4. Adrian

5. Arthur

6. Oliver

7. Paul

8. Isaac

9. Louis

10. Travis


What makes a good nickname?

There are a couple of things you should pay attention to.

First, and most importantly, a nickname should be a way to show love and affection. Yes, it can be humorous and teasing, but always in a loving manner. The last thing you want to do is insult someone.

When choosing a moniker, try to go for something that will positively emphasize the traits of a person.

You can get your inspiration from all sorts of things, such as their favorite food, hometown, physical attributes, or personality traits. You should also pay attention to rhyming.

Now that you have plenty of amazing nicknames for John, you won’t have any trouble choosing the perfect one.

Until next time!

Read next: Nicknames For Daniel: List Of 190 Original Nicknames

120 Amazing Nicknames For John Every John Will Approve Of